There's no place like home for Lafayette, who bounced back after a loss on the road last Friday. They took their contest at home on Friday with ease, bagging a 43-0 win over the Brookwood Warriors. That's more bragging rights for the Hornets, who also won the pair's last head-to-head.
Lafayette was led to victory by Dayne Mccray and Tywan K Williamson. Mccray rushed for 161 yards and a touchdown on only 13 carries, while K Williamson threw for 81 yards and three touchdowns on perfect 6-for-6passing. The dominant performance gave Mccray a new career-high in rushing yards.
On the other side of the ball, a lot of the credit has to go to Lafayette's defense and their 4.5 sacks. Zamarion Hawkins was especially locked on to Brookwood's QB and sacked him three times.
Lafayette now has a winning record of 2-1. As for Brookwood, they are on a six-game losing streak (dating back to last season) that has dropped them down to 0-4.
Lafayette will head out on the road to face off against Chiefland at 7:30 p.m. on Friday. Chiefland will roll in looking for their fourth straight victory, something Lafayette surely won't give up without a fight. As for Brookwood, they will have plenty of time to ponder what went wrong as they've got a bye scheduled next week. After, they'll take on Frederica Academy at 7:30 p.m. on September 20th.
